Exported features of Primitives and their elements

Objects and features supported for export to all four radiation programs

Object or feature Exported to ESARAD, TSS, Thermica, and Step-Tas as Exported to TRASYS as
Primitive created by parameters Primitive created by parameters (ESARAD, TSS, and Thermica)Primitive created by points (Step-Tas) N/A
Primitive created by points Primitive created by points N/A
Primitive translations and rotations Primitive translations and rotations N/A
Element ID, position, and sequence Element ID, position, and sequence for triangular, quadrilateral, and beam elements. Other elements are ignored. N/A
Elements not part of a primitive definition Individual primitives Individual surface primitives (TYPE=POLY)
Curved parabolic elements Individual primitives Individual surface primitives (TYPE=DISK, CONE, CYL, SPHERO, OR PARAB)
Element thickness (physical property) Element thickness Element thickness
Units (length and material properties) Converted to SI units before export Converted to SI units before export
Some material properties See the table in Primitive material properties supported for export.

Primitive material properties supported for export

The following primitive material properties are supported for export:

Simcenter 3D Space Systems Thermal Material Property Exported as TSS property Exported as ESARAD property Exported as Thermica property Exported as TRASYS Exported as Step-Tas
Mass density density density mass_density
Thermal conductivity beta_cond1 cond thermal_conductivity
Specific Heat spec_heat spec heat constant_pressure_specific_heat_capacity
IR emissivity (top side) ir_eps (a-side) ir emiss (opt1) EPSILON(e1) EMISS (TOP) infra_red_emittance
IR emissivity (bottom side) ir_eps (b-side) ir emiss (opt2) EPSILON(e2) EMISS (BOTH) infra_red_emittance
IR specular reflectivity (top side) ir_spec (a-side) ir spec refl (opt1) SPECE(se1) infra_red_specularity
IR specular reflectivity (bottom side) ir_spec (b-side) ir spec refl (opt2) SPECE(se2) infra_red_specularity
IR transmissivity ir_trans ir transm (opt1) infra_red_diffuse_transmittance
Solar absorptivity (top side) sol_eps (a-side) solar absorp (opt1) ALPHA(a1) ALPHA (TOP) solar_absorptance
Solar absorptivity (bottom side) sol_eps (b-side) solar absorp (opt2) ALPHA(a2) ALPHA (BOTH) solar_absorptance
Solar specular reflectivity (top side) sol_spec (a-side) solar refl (opt1) SPECA(s1) SPRS (TOP) solar_specularity
Solar specular reflectivity (bottom side) sol_spec (b-side) solar refl (opt2) SPECA(s2) SPRS (BOTH) solar_specularity
Solar index of refraction (top side) sol_refract (a-side) solar_refraction_index
Solar index of refraction (bottom side) sol_refract (b-side) solar_refraction_index
Solar transmissivity sol_trans solar transm (opt1) TRANS solar_diffuse_transmittance

Note:

Orthotropic conductivity is supported for import/export with TSS (beta_cond = KXX, gamma_cond = KYY, theta_cond = KZZ).
